Exploding Block Baby Quilt
 
1 Attachment(s)
Someone last week posted the link to Jenny Doan's Exploding Block tutorial. Along in the posting someone mentioned they wondered how a baby quilt would look using this method. So I tried it! I needed to make a baby girl quilt, had lots of pinks in my stash and was looking for something fun and quick. I started with a pinwheel block center and added on (Exploded it) from there. I added 5 rounds to the pinwheel and it measured 32" square before I added two sashings. Now it's 42" square and ready to sandwich and quilt! This was a really fun and easy top to make! If you're going to try it be sure to square off after each addition of fabric and I think 5 rounds was enough so quilt was still manageable. Here's my pic:
